How the Steam Platform Changed PC Gaming Forever
Steam fundamentally restructured how players access, purchase, and play games on personal computers, transforming PC gaming from a fragmented landscape of physical media and scattered digital storefronts into a unified ecosystem. Launched by Valve Corporation in 2003, Steam introduced digital distribution at scale when most players still bought games in boxes at retail stores, establishing a model that the entire industry would eventually adopt. Understanding Steam’s impact requires examining how it solved critical problems in PC gaming, reshaped developer-publisher relationships, and created new possibilities for independent creators.
The Pre-Steam PC Gaming Landscape and the Distribution Problem
Before Steam’s arrival, PC gaming operated through physical retail channels and scattered digital marketplaces that created friction for both players and developers. Players purchased games on compact discs or DVD media from stores, dealt with installation complications, manual patching through websites, and faced compatibility issues across different systems. Developers struggled with piracy, had limited visibility into player behavior, and depended on retail partners who controlled shelf space and pricing, creating bottlenecks that prevented many smaller studios from reaching audiences.
The retail-dependent model meant that games had limited shelf lives in stores. A title that didn’t generate immediate sales would disappear from shelves, becoming effectively unavailable to new players, while developers lost revenue opportunities from interested buyers who arrived after the initial retail window closed. This system also made it difficult for players to discover games beyond what major publishers could afford to market and retail chains chose to stock.
Steam’s Core Innovation: Centralized Digital Distribution with Automatic Updates
Steam introduced a centralized digital storefront where players downloaded games directly to their computers rather than purchasing physical media, while simultaneously providing automatic patching and update systems that eliminated the manual installation and configuration processes that plagued earlier PC gaming. The platform used client software—a program users installed on their computers—to manage game libraries, handle downloads, and apply updates in the background without requiring player intervention. This approach solved the piracy problem by tying games to user accounts, allowing developers to track legitimate copies and update them continuously to prevent unauthorized distribution.
The Half-Life 2 launch in 2004 demonstrated Steam’s potential when Valve made the game available exclusively through the platform, forcing millions of players to adopt the service. While this created initial resistance from players accustomed to owning physical copies, it proved that digital distribution could work at scale and that players would accept it for convenient access to major titles. Within a few years, the convenience of automatic updates and centralized game management converted skeptics into advocates.
The Network Effect and the Rise of the Steam Marketplace
Steam’s power increased exponentially as more developers joined the platform, attracting more players, which in turn attracted more developers—a self-reinforcing cycle known as network effect. The platform created a unified social layer where players could see what friends were playing, join multiplayer games directly, and share achievements, transforming PC gaming from an isolated experience into a connected social space. This social infrastructure became increasingly valuable as more players joined, making Steam not just a store but a community platform.
The introduction of user reviews on Steam created a transparent feedback system that empowered players and created accountability for developers in ways retail stores never could. Games like Terraria, originally a niche title with modest expectations, found massive audiences through positive word-of-mouth and community engagement on Steam, demonstrating that quality indie games could compete with major releases when given proper visibility. This democratization of discoverability fundamentally changed which games succeeded commercially.
Evolution from Store to Ecosystem: Workshop, Greenlight, and Early Access
Over its first decade, Steam evolved from a distribution platform into a comprehensive ecosystem that supported game development at every stage. The Steam Workshop launched in 2011, allowing players to create and share modifications and custom content directly through the platform, while the developer received tools to integrate this user-generated content seamlessly. Greenlight, introduced in 2012, let the community vote on which games should appear on Steam’s store, shifting curation power from corporate gatekeepers to players themselves and opening the platform to thousands of independent developers who previously had no viable distribution channel.
Early Access, launched in 2013, created a new business model where developers could release games in development stages, gather player feedback, and generate revenue while still improving the product. Successful Early Access titles like PlayerUnknown’s Battlegrounds and Valheim demonstrated that players would pay for unfinished games if they offered compelling experiences and clear development roadmaps, creating a new funding mechanism that reduced financial risk for independent studios. This feature particularly benefited smaller studios that lacked the capital to fund development entirely before release.
Impact on Game Development and Industry Structure
Steam’s dominance in PC game distribution fundamentally altered the economics of game development and the relationship between creators and publishers. Independent developers gained direct access to millions of potential customers without requiring publishing deals or retail partnerships, enabling solo developers and small teams to achieve commercial success previously reserved for well-funded studios. The platform’s revenue sharing model—where Valve took a percentage of sales while developers retained the remainder—proved more favorable than traditional retail arrangements where publishers and distributors took substantial cuts.
The success of indie games on Steam created a thriving alternative to AAA (big-budget, major studio) game development. Games like Stardew Valley, created by one person, and Among Us, developed by a small team, achieved mainstream recognition and financial success through Steam distribution alone, proving that audience size and production budget did not determine commercial viability. This shift enabled greater creative diversity, as developers could pursue niche concepts and artistic visions without needing approval from corporate publishers.
Technical Infrastructure and the Shift to Digital Ownership Models
Steam introduced players to digital ownership through licensing rather than traditional ownership of physical copies, a model that raised important questions about consumer rights and game preservation. When players purchase a game on Steam, they acquire a license to play the game as long as their account remains active and Valve maintains the servers, rather than owning a physical product they can resell or preserve indefinitely. This licensing model became the industry standard, though it created concerns about long-term game preservation and player access if companies shut down services.
The platform’s infrastructure supports simultaneous downloads for millions of users through content delivery networks, which are systems of distributed servers designed to deliver content efficiently across geographic regions. This technical foundation made releasing games to global audiences feasible without the supply chain complications of manufacturing and distributing physical media. Developers could update games instantly worldwide, fix bugs within hours rather than months, and respond to player feedback in real-time—capabilities that fundamentally changed how games evolved after release.

How does Steam’s revenue sharing work for developers?
Steam takes a 30% cut of game sales, allowing developers to retain 70% of revenue—a significantly better arrangement than traditional retail distribution where publishers, distributors, and retailers collectively took 50% or more. This revenue model has remained relatively consistent since Steam’s launch, though Valve introduced tiered rates where developers with higher sales volumes can negotiate slightly better percentages.
Why did other companies create alternative PC gaming platforms?
As Steam’s dominance became apparent, other publishers and companies created competing platforms to avoid paying Steam’s commission, with Epic Games launching the Epic Games Store in 2018 as the most prominent example. These competing platforms offered exclusive games and different revenue splits, but none achieved Steam’s market penetration, with Steam maintaining approximately 75% of the PC digital game distribution market.
